Why is the red colour selected for danger signal lights?
Exam-ready answer • 02 Mark
✓Answer
Red colour is selected for danger signal lights because it has the longest wavelength and is scattered the least by the particles present in the atmosphere.
As a result, red light can travel a greater distance and remains clearly visible even in fog, mist, smoke, or dust. Therefore, it is used for danger signals, traffic lights, and stop signals.
